Utilizing Electric Vehicles

Electric vehicles (EVs) have emerged as a sustainable transport option in logistics, reducing greenhouse gas emissions and reliance on fossil fuels. By utilizing EVs in transportation fleets, companies can significantly lower their carbon footprint and contribute to environmental conservation efforts. The advancements in EV technology have improved their range, charging infrastructure, and cost-effectiveness, making them a viable solution for eco-conscious logistics operations.

One of the key benefits of incorporating electric vehicles in logistics is the reduction of air pollution in urban areas, where transportation activities often contribute to smog and health hazards. Electric trucks and vans are particularly suitable for short-haul deliveries and last-mile distribution, where frequent stops and starts can significantly impact air quality. By transitioning to electric vehicles, companies can mitigate the negative environmental impacts associated with traditional diesel-powered vehicles.

Moreover, the operational costs of electric vehicles are lower in the long run due to reduced maintenance and fuel expenses. With the increasing availability of charging stations and incentives for EV adoption, logistics companies can invest in a cleaner and more sustainable transportation fleet. By prioritizing the use of electric vehicles, businesses can demonstrate their commitment to environmental considerations in logistics and foster a positive reputation for sustainable practices in the industry.

Implementing Hybrid Technologies

Implementing hybrid technologies in logistics involves integrating vehicles that utilize a combination of traditional fuel and alternative power sources to enhance efficiency and reduce emissions. This approach plays a pivotal role in addressing environmental considerations within transportation systems. Hybrid technologies offer a sustainable solution by leveraging both electric and conventional propulsion methods to achieve optimal performance while minimizing environmental impact.

Key strategies for implementing hybrid technologies include:

  • Incorporating regenerative braking systems to capture and store energy, improving overall fuel efficiency.
  • Utilizing advanced power management systems to seamlessly switch between power sources based on operational demands, optimizing energy utilization.
  • Integrating intelligent telematics systems to monitor and analyze vehicle performance, facilitating data-driven decision-making for enhanced operational efficiency.

Eco-Friendly Warehousing Practices

Eco-Friendly Warehousing Practices play a significant role in reducing the environmental impact of logistics operations. By implementing sustainable strategies within warehouse facilities, businesses can contribute to a greener supply chain. Some key practices include:

  1. Maximizing Energy Efficiency:

    • Installing LED lighting and motion sensors to reduce electricity consumption.
    • Implementing energy management systems to monitor and optimize usage.
  2. Adopting Renewable Energy Sources:

    • Utilizing solar panels or wind turbines to power warehouse operations.
    • Investing in energy-efficient heating and cooling systems.
  3. Implementing Recycling Initiatives:

    • Setting up designated recycling stations for materials like cardboard, paper, and plastics.
    • Partnering with recycling facilities to ensure proper disposal of waste materials.

Water Conservation Measures

Water conservation measures in logistics play a pivotal role in sustainable operations. By implementing efficient water management strategies, companies can minimize their environmental impact and contribute to resource preservation. Some key water conservation measures include:

  • Installing water-efficient fixtures: Utilizing faucets, toilets, and other equipment designed for reduced water consumption helps in curbing water wastage.
  • Implementing rainwater harvesting systems: Capturing and storing rainwater for non-potable purposes within logistics facilities reduces reliance on freshwater sources.
  • Monitoring and optimizing water usage: Regularly tracking water consumption levels and identifying areas for improvement can lead to significant conservation outcomes.

Embracing these water conservation practices not only promotes eco-consciousness but also contributes to cost savings and regulatory compliance in the logistics sector. Sustainable water management is integral to fostering environmental stewardship and resilience in operational frameworks.

Carbon Footprint Reduction

Carbon footprint reduction in logistics encompasses a range of strategies and practices aimed at minimizing the environmental impact of transportation and supply chain operations. To effectively reduce carbon emissions within the logistics industry, companies can adopt various measures such as:

  • Implementing Fuel-Efficient Vehicles: Prioritizing the use of fuel-efficient trucks and vehicles can significantly reduce carbon emissions during transportation activities.
  • Optimizing Route Planning: Utilizing advanced route optimization technology helps streamline delivery routes, ultimately cutting down on fuel consumption and emissions.
  • Embracing Alternative Fuels: Transitioning to renewable energy sources like biofuels or hydrogen can further diminish carbon footprints associated with logistics operations.
